David Simon: A Verified Profile of the Wire Creator and Showrunner

Early Life and Education

David Simon was born in Washington, D.C., and grew up in the Silver Spring area of Maryland. He attended the University of Maryland, College Park, where he studied journalism and history. These formative years shaped his methodical, detail-first approach to storytelling and set the foundation for his future in reporting and television.

Journalism Career Before Television

Simon began his professional life as a police reporter for The Baltimore Sun. His immersive work covering crime and city government provided firsthand experience that later became the bedrock of his acclaimed television work. He documented urban policy, institutional behavior, and community impact with a precision that distinguished him in journalism.

Breakthrough in Television: The Wire

David Simon is best known as the creator, showrunner, and head writer of The Wire. The series examined the interconnected systems of a city through the lens of law enforcement, politics, schools, and the port. Its realistic dialogue, large ensemble cast, and structural ambition redefined prestige television for many viewers and critics.

Key Roles on The Wire

Simon served as executive producer and wrote a substantial portion of the series’ landmark episodes. He collaborated closely with Ed Burns, a former Baltimore police detective, to ensure authenticity. His leadership grounded the show in lived experience and institutional research.

Post-The Wire Television Work

After The Wire, Simon created Treme, focusing on post-Katrina New Orleans and its cultural resilience. He also developed The Plot Against America, an alternate-history drama based on the novel by Philip Roth. In addition, he consulted on other projects and public discussions about narrative television and journalism.

Style, Themes, and Influence

Simon’s work is characterized by long-form storytelling, naturalistic dialogue, and a skeptical view of institutional solutions. He often explores how policies manifest on the street level and how individuals navigate complex systems. His journalistic instincts inform tight plotting and morally ambiguous characters.

Public Persona and Statements

In interviews and public appearances, Simon has discussed the responsibilities of creators, the decline of traditional newsrooms, and the challenges of representing complex cities on screen. He has been candid about the limits of storytelling in the face of structural inequities, while continuing to advocate for nuanced, patient narrative forms.

Legacy and Cultural Impact

By prioritizing institutional perspective and ensemble storytelling, David Simon influenced a generation of television creators. The Wire remains a benchmark for serialized drama that treats its audience as capable of following intricate, systemic narratives. His blend of journalism and fiction set a lasting template for ambitious long-form television.
